Visit the Famous Senso-ji Temple
Step into Tokyo’s oldest Buddhist temple, where history comes alive in every corner. The moment you walk through the massive Thunder Gate with its giant red lantern, you will feel transported back in time. The path to the temple, called Nakamise Shopping Street, is lined with small shops selling traditional snacks and souvenirs – perfect for finding unique gifts!
Do not miss the giant incense burner in the temple’s courtyard; locals believe the smoke brings good health. Remember to look up at the stunning five-story pagoda. Early morning visits help you avoid the crowds and capture perfect photos.
Dive into Anime and Gaming in Akihabara
Welcome to Electric Town, where anime and gaming dreams come true! You do not have to be a huge fan to feel the buzz in Akihabara. Multi-story arcade buildings buzz with the sounds of gaming machines, while colourful shops overflow with action figures and collectables. Pop into a maid café for a unique experience – these themed cafés serve cute desserts with a side of entertainment.
Browse towering electronics stores where you can find the latest gadgets, often months before they are available elsewhere. Do not forget to check out the gachapon machines – these vending machines dispense cute capsule toys that make perfect souvenirs.
Experience the Buzz at Shibuya Crossing
Welcome to the busiest pedestrian crossing in the world, where up to 3,000 people cross simultaneously during peak times! It is like watching a perfectly choreographed dance as crowds weave through each other when the lights change. Get a coffee at the Starbucks with a view of the crossing, or jump right in—it is safe even if it looks busy!
The massive video screens and neon signs create a setup that feels straight out of a movie. Stop by in the morning and return at night to see how different it looks. Do not forget to snap a photo with the famous Hachiko statue nearby, celebrating the most loyal dog in Japan.
Enjoy Panoramic Views From Tokyo Skytree
Rising 634 meters into the sky, Tokyo Skytree offers views that will take your breath away. The elevator ride alone is exciting, with special effects making you feel like you are blasting off into space! On clear days, Mount Fuji stands visible in the distance, while at night, the city sparkles with endless lights.
The observation deck features glass floors for the brave-hearted and a café where you can sip coffee while floating above the city. Pro tip: Visit before sunset to enjoy views of both day and night. Buy tickets online to avoid long queues.
Discover the Elegance of Geisha Culture
Kyoto is famous for geishas, but you can also see them in Tokyo’s Asakusa district. Join a cultural workshop where you can learn about their intricate kimonos, traditional arts, and the years of training required to master their crafts.
Some tea houses now offer special experiences where visitors can enjoy traditional performances and even try on kimono themselves. Remember to be respectful when taking photos, as this is a living, breathing part of Japanese culture, not just a tourist attraction.
